C# Class AIMS_BD_IATI.DAL.AimsDbIatiDAL

Afficher le fichier Open project: BD-IATI/edi Class Usage Examples

Private Properties

Свойство Type Description
GetMappedAimsProjects List
GetNotMappedAimsProjects List
LoadChildActivities void
ParseXMLAndResolve List
PrepareMappedActivities List

Méthodes publiques

Méthode Description
AimsDbIatiDAL ( ) : AIMS_BD_IATI.Library.Parser.ParserIATIv2
AssignActivities ( List activities ) : int
GetAllActivities ( string dp ) : iatiactivityContainer
GetAssignActivities ( string dp, bool mappedOnly = false ) : CFnTFModel
GetAssignedActivityCount ( string dp ) : int
GetCofinanceProjects ( string dp ) : List
GetDelegatedActivities ( string dp ) : List
GetFieldMappingPreferenceActivity ( string iatiIdentifier ) : List
GetFieldMappingPreferenceDelegated ( string iatiIdentifier ) : List
GetFieldMappingPreferenceGeneral ( string dp ) : List
GetLastDayLogs ( string dp ) : List
GetLastDownloadDate ( string dp ) : DateTime?
GetMappedActivities ( string dp ) : iatiactivityContainer
GetMappedActivityCount ( string dp ) : int
GetNewActivityCount ( string dp ) : int
GetNotMappedActivities ( string dp ) : iatiactivityContainer
GetTotalActivityCount ( string dp ) : int
GetTransactionMismatchedActivity ( string iatiIdentifier ) : ProjectFieldMapModel
GetTrustFundProjects ( string dp ) : List
InsertLog ( Log log ) : int
MapActivities ( List activities ) : int
RecallDelegatedActivity ( ActivityModel activity ) : int
SaveAtivities ( List activities, List iatiActivities, tblFundSource fundSource ) : int
SaveAtivity ( Activity activity, iatiactivity iatiActivity, tblFundSource fundSource ) : int
SaveFieldMappingPreferenceActivity ( List fieldMaps ) : int
SaveFieldMappingPreferenceDelegated ( List fieldMaps ) : int
SaveFieldMappingPreferenceGeneral ( List fieldMaps ) : int
SetCurrencyExRateAndVal ( ICurrency tr, string defaultcurrency, System.DateTime trDate = default(DateTime) ) : void
SetExchangedValues ( iatiactivity activity ) : void
SetIgnoreActivity ( string iatiIdentifier ) : int
UnMapActivity ( string iatiIdentifier ) : int
UpdateLog ( Log log ) : int

Private Methods

Méthode Description
GetMappedAimsProjects ( string dp ) : List
GetNotMappedAimsProjects ( string dp ) : List
LoadChildActivities ( iatiactivity activity ) : void
ParseXMLAndResolve ( List q ) : List
PrepareMappedActivities ( List iatiActivities, Activity a, AimsDAL aimsDAL ) : List

Method Details

AimsDbIatiDAL() public méthode

public AimsDbIatiDAL ( ) : AIMS_BD_IATI.Library.Parser.ParserIATIv2
Résultat AIMS_BD_IATI.Library.Parser.ParserIATIv2

AssignActivities() public méthode

public AssignActivities ( List activities ) : int
activities List
Résultat int

GetAllActivities() public méthode

public GetAllActivities ( string dp ) : iatiactivityContainer
dp string
Résultat AIMS_BD_IATI.Library.Parser.ParserIATIv2.iatiactivityContainer

GetAssignActivities() public méthode

public GetAssignActivities ( string dp, bool mappedOnly = false ) : CFnTFModel
dp string
mappedOnly bool
Résultat AIMS_BD_IATI.Library.Parser.ParserIATIv2.CFnTFModel

GetAssignedActivityCount() public méthode

public GetAssignedActivityCount ( string dp ) : int
dp string
Résultat int

GetCofinanceProjects() public méthode

public GetCofinanceProjects ( string dp ) : List
dp string
Résultat List

GetDelegatedActivities() public méthode

public GetDelegatedActivities ( string dp ) : List
dp string
Résultat List

GetFieldMappingPreferenceActivity() public méthode

public GetFieldMappingPreferenceActivity ( string iatiIdentifier ) : List
iatiIdentifier string
Résultat List

GetFieldMappingPreferenceDelegated() public méthode

public GetFieldMappingPreferenceDelegated ( string iatiIdentifier ) : List
iatiIdentifier string
Résultat List

GetFieldMappingPreferenceGeneral() public méthode

public GetFieldMappingPreferenceGeneral ( string dp ) : List
dp string
Résultat List

GetLastDayLogs() public méthode

public GetLastDayLogs ( string dp ) : List
dp string
Résultat List

GetLastDownloadDate() public méthode

public GetLastDownloadDate ( string dp ) : DateTime?
dp string
Résultat DateTime?

GetMappedActivities() public méthode

public GetMappedActivities ( string dp ) : iatiactivityContainer
dp string
Résultat AIMS_BD_IATI.Library.Parser.ParserIATIv2.iatiactivityContainer

GetMappedActivityCount() public méthode

public GetMappedActivityCount ( string dp ) : int
dp string
Résultat int

GetNewActivityCount() public méthode

public GetNewActivityCount ( string dp ) : int
dp string
Résultat int

GetNotMappedActivities() public méthode

public GetNotMappedActivities ( string dp ) : iatiactivityContainer
dp string
Résultat AIMS_BD_IATI.Library.Parser.ParserIATIv2.iatiactivityContainer

GetTotalActivityCount() public méthode

public GetTotalActivityCount ( string dp ) : int
dp string
Résultat int

GetTransactionMismatchedActivity() public méthode

public GetTransactionMismatchedActivity ( string iatiIdentifier ) : ProjectFieldMapModel
iatiIdentifier string
Résultat ProjectFieldMapModel

GetTrustFundProjects() public méthode

public GetTrustFundProjects ( string dp ) : List
dp string
Résultat List

InsertLog() public méthode

public InsertLog ( Log log ) : int
log Log
Résultat int

MapActivities() public méthode

public MapActivities ( List activities ) : int
activities List
Résultat int

RecallDelegatedActivity() public méthode

public RecallDelegatedActivity ( ActivityModel activity ) : int
activity ActivityModel
Résultat int

SaveAtivities() public méthode

public SaveAtivities ( List activities, List iatiActivities, tblFundSource fundSource ) : int
activities List
iatiActivities List
fundSource tblFundSource
Résultat int

SaveAtivity() public méthode

public SaveAtivity ( Activity activity, iatiactivity iatiActivity, tblFundSource fundSource ) : int
activity Activity
iatiActivity iatiactivity
fundSource tblFundSource
Résultat int

SaveFieldMappingPreferenceActivity() public méthode

public SaveFieldMappingPreferenceActivity ( List fieldMaps ) : int
fieldMaps List
Résultat int

SaveFieldMappingPreferenceDelegated() public méthode

public SaveFieldMappingPreferenceDelegated ( List fieldMaps ) : int
fieldMaps List
Résultat int

SaveFieldMappingPreferenceGeneral() public méthode

public SaveFieldMappingPreferenceGeneral ( List fieldMaps ) : int
fieldMaps List
Résultat int

SetCurrencyExRateAndVal() public méthode

public SetCurrencyExRateAndVal ( ICurrency tr, string defaultcurrency, System.DateTime trDate = default(DateTime) ) : void
tr ICurrency
defaultcurrency string
trDate System.DateTime
Résultat void

SetExchangedValues() public méthode

public SetExchangedValues ( iatiactivity activity ) : void
activity iatiactivity
Résultat void

SetIgnoreActivity() public méthode

public SetIgnoreActivity ( string iatiIdentifier ) : int
iatiIdentifier string
Résultat int

UnMapActivity() public méthode

public UnMapActivity ( string iatiIdentifier ) : int
iatiIdentifier string
Résultat int

UpdateLog() public méthode

public UpdateLog ( Log log ) : int
log Log
Résultat int